We are working to align our website with the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) 2.1 Level AA. This includes attention to text contrast, clear headings, consistent layout, and meaningful structure. We also review our content so that users searching for carpet cleaning services in SE23 can more easily understand what is offered and move through pages without confusion.
Our site is designed to support screen-reader support by using semantic heading levels, descriptive link text, and structured content. Where possible, we avoid unnecessary jargon and make sure that important information is written in a straightforward way. We also aim to ensure that images and non-text elements are presented in ways that assistive technology can interpret appropriately.
Keyboard navigation is another important part of accessibility. Users should be able to move through the site using only a keyboard, including between menu items, forms, and page sections. We review interactive elements to help ensure they can be reached and activated without a mouse. This is especially important for people who rely on alternative input methods or prefer to browse in a different way.
